Victoria Street is in Long Eaton, Nottingham and in Erewash district. NG10 3EW is located in the Sawley elect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Erewash.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is Victoria Street dangerous?

In 2023, 490 crimes were reported near Victoria Street . Only 21%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ered not safe. The most common type of crime was shoplifting.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of NG10 3EW.

Crime statistics are based on data provided by Home Office through data.police.uk under the Open Government Licence.
